What's Typically Covered

Vasectomy is usually covered under your health insurance plan's family planning or contraception benefits. Many plans cover:

  • The consultation appointment

  • The vasectomy procedure itself

  • Follow-up appointments

  • Post-procedure semen analysis

Coverage can range from 80-100% depending on your specific plan and whether you've met your deductible.

Your Out-of-Pocket Costs

Your actual costs will depend on several factors:

  • Deductible: The amount you pay before insurance kicks in

  • Copay: A fixed fee per visit or procedure

  • Coinsurance: The percentage you pay after meeting your deductible

  • In-network vs. out-of-network: In-network providers typically cost less
